#781c6e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#781c6e is composed of 47.1% red, 11%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.7% magenta, 8.3%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 306.5 degrees, a saturation of 62.2% and a lightness of 29%. #781c6e color hex could be obtained by blending #f038dc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#781c6e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#781c6e has RGB values of R:120, G:28,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.08,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7871598.
